The specialists kept in mind that a person session can cost anywhere from $300 to $1,500 (the rate largely relies on the area), however Sinead states it is essential to understand that a "greater cost doesn't assure top quality work."Included in the rate is a touch-up within 4 to 6 weeks after your initial visit since "40 percent of the pigment that's infused right into the skin will discolor, so the professional requires to go back in and also reinfuse," Dmitriyeva states.

If you have a medical condition or take medicines that cause you to shed your eyebrows, you might want to inspect to see if your health and wellness insurance provider will certainly agree to cover the treatment. Because microblading is a semipermanent treatment, your brows will certainly last anywhere from 1 to 3 years.

Depending on your skin kind and preferred look, you'll require a touch-up application every 6 months or each year, due to the fact that the pigment will begin to discolor. If you have oily skin, the pigment may not last as long, because the oil secretions make it much more challenging for it to efficiently abide by your skin.

Yet if you wait longer for a touch-up than advised by your service technician, you might have to duplicate the entire microblading procedure. Touch-ups are commonly a little bit more than half of the expense of the microblading treatment. So, if your microblading session costs $1,000, the touch-up application may possibly cost around $600.

Treatment And Maintenance There are various ways you can assist safeguard your microbladed eyebrows following your treatment, consisting of: Stay clear of putting make-up on the location as you will certainly have open injuries where the ink was put under your skin.

Moisture can likewise cause the scabs to find off earlier than they should. Minimize direct exposure to guide sunlight as sunburns can make the ink fade faster and effect the healing process of your injuries. It's also best to listen to any care guidance your cosmetician offers you after the treatment.
